I no longer even have the little speaker icon near the clock, and when i try to play a song on itunes it wont even play so im not really sure what i deleted and when i go to my control panel and go to audio device is it says that none are avalible yet i have speakers hooked up and i am sure they work..please help me with this problem if you can and soon please ..Thank You

check you have pluged into the green one that is sound out
check you have power to your speakers.
open control panal / sounds and audio devices
check to see if mute is ticked (untick it )click on advanced in that area check others are not muted ( done )
right click my computer / properties / hardware / device manager
check for any "(?)" with yellow or green background, if there are under sound ,video, game controlers, reinstall your sound and video drivers that came with you pc
if you find any with a red x right click them , then click enable

Reinstall the audio drivers. You get the audio drivers off the net. Eg if you have a dell, go to dell.com look for the support/download section it will ask you for the model of your computer and list all of the drivers. Follow the instuctions.
